16 Great Neck RoadNorth <br />-Mashpee, -Massachusetts 02649 <br />Ms. Waygan noted to label the photo that he would like Mr. Pesce to monitor. We will ask Mr. <br />Pesce to continue to monitor that area, that we are not satisfied enough to close it out until <br />there is more grass for the swales. <br />It was questioned whether those mounds are up to the Building Inspector. Ms. Waygan would <br />like to keep the $2,000.00 until the area around the drainage swale has more grass. <br />MOTION: <br />Mr. Richardson made a motion to retain the $2,000.00 until the area around the <br />drainage has more grass. Seconded by Mr. Balzarini. All in favor. <br />The Building Inspector has been notified and he confirmed the attractive nuisance, we need to <br />change our wording for unbuilt lots and storage use. <br />CHAIRS REPORT <br />Ms. Waygan went to the public meeting with the Cape Cod Commission about community land <br />trusts and housing land banks. They hired a great consultant and some feedback provided was <br />how we want to use our existing structures for this work and preserve town character. These <br />entities should have architectural standards and site design standards and be town owned <br />property for affordable structures. <br />TOWN PLANNER REPORT <br />Inspection Fees <br />Mr. Fudala drafted two articles to straighten out the fees. There is a Public Hearing scheduled <br />for Special Permit Rules and Regulation and Subdivision changes on December 4, 2024. He <br />wrote `as required' for consultant fees.
